Skip to content

romabelka/js_ru_21_09

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

56 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

js_ru_21_09

##HT1.1 Создать список комментов к статье ##HT1.2 Открывать/закрывать список по нажатию на кнопку(менять на ней текст) ##HT1.3 Написать для всего propTypes ##HT1.4 Починить close для статей

##HT2.1 Написать декоратор для аккордеона ##HT2.2 Написать класс с наследованием для аккоредона

##HT3.1 Добавить календарь(https://github.com/gpbl/react-day-picker) с выбором диапазона дат, выводить этот диапазон текстом ##HT3.2 добавить форму(user, text) для добавления комментария к статье(без функционала добавления), чистить ее по сабмиту ##HT3.3 валидировать ее: не больше 50 символов, не меньше 10(подсвечивать красным) ##HT3.4 не давать засабмитить невалидную форму

##HT4.1 Вынести состояние фильтров в store ##HT4.2 Реализовать фильтрацию статей для ArticleList

##HT5.1 Создать Middleware для генерации рандомных id ##HT5.2 Реализовать добавление коммента к статье

##HT6.1 Переписать комменты на immutable ##HT6.2 Реализовать загрузку комментов при открытии списка, загружать их один раз для статьи(api /api/comment?article=56c782f18990ecf954f6e027) ##HT6.3 Показывать лоадер

##HT7.1 Сделать роут для пагинации комментов(/comments/1) ##HT7.2 Реализовать пагинацию всех комментов(по 5 на странице), загружать каждую страницу 1 раз(/api/comment?limit=5&offset=5)

##HT8.1 Реализовать локализацию, поместив словарь в контекст ##HT8.2 Подготовить список вопросов для финальной встречи, ПРИСЛАТЬ ИХ НА ПОЧТУ

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ages